概括
将预处理与暗发酵 (DF) 和微生物电解细胞 (MEC) 整合起来,可以显著提高从纤维素生物质中生产的生物的产量. 这种综合方法提高了甘包的能量回收,提供了更有效的可持续能源解决方案.

主要成果:
- 与未经处理的基质相比,预处理的包在DF过程中产生了显著更高的生物 (3.4 L/L).
- 在+0.7V时,MEC实现了0.9L/L的最大产量.
- 集成的DF-MEC系统显示了21%的能量回收,超过了单阶段的DF (12.4%).

Bioremediation is the use of prokaryotes, fungi, or plants to remove pollutants from the environment. This process has been used to remove harmful toxins in groundwater as a byproduct of agricultural run-off and also to clean up oil spills.
